Warning Signs You Need Structural Repair Water Damage
Catching structural water damage early can save you significant time and money. Ignoring these signs can turn small issues into costly, complex repairs. Your home is a big investment, and its structural integrity is paramount. We want to help you identify potential problems before they escalate.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Persistent musty or moldy smells, especially in basements or crawl spaces, often indicate hidden moisture within structural components. This is a common sign of developing wood rot.
Visible Water Stains or Discoloration
Stains on ceilings, walls, or floors, especially those that appear to be spreading or darkening, suggest water is actively seeping into the structure. Look for newly appearing marks.
Sagging or Uneven Floors
Floors that feel soft, spongy, or noticeably sag or dip can indicate that subflooring or joists are water-damaged and losing their strength. This is a serious sign of structural compromise.
Cracks in Walls or Ceilings
While some minor settling cracks are normal, new or widening cracks, especially near water sources or in load-bearing areas, could be a sign of structural stress from moisture. Pay attention to expanding fissures.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int/Wallpaper
Moisture trapped behind paint or wallpaper can cause it to blister, bubble, or peel away from the underlying surface, indicating water intrusion. This points to underlying moisture issues.
Warped Door or Window Frames
Frames that appear warped, making doors or windows difficult to open or close, can be a sign that the surrounding structural wood has absorbed too much moisture and expanded. This indicates frame distortion.
Structural Repair Water Damage v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Minor surface staining on a wall from a small leak | Yes, if the source is fixed and the area is dried. | No | Easy to clean and monitor. |
| Suspected water in a crawl space after heavy rain | No | Yes | Crawl spaces are hard to access and dry thoroughly. |
| Soft spots or sagging in the subfloor | No | Yes | Indicates joist or subfloor damage requiring professional assessment. |
| Musty odors in a finished basement | Maybe, if you can locate and dry the source quickly. | Yes | Hidden moisture behind walls or under floors is common. |
| Visible mold growth on structural wood | No | Yes | Mold requires specialized removal to prevent health risks and further damage. |
| Water damage around a plumbing leak in a wall | No | Yes | Hidden pipes and structural elements need careful inspection and repair. |
For any situation involving potential damage to your home’s core framework, calling a professional is almost always the smarter choice. DIY fixes might seem cost-effective initially, but they often fail to address the underlying issues, leading to more extensive and expensive repairs later. Will my homeowner’s insurance cover structural repair water damage?
In most cases, homeowner’s insurance policies cover structural damage caused by sudden and accidental water events, like burst pipes or storms. Damage from slow leaks or poor maintenance is often excluded. What kind of equipment do you use for structural drying?
We use a variety of industrial-grade equipment, including high-powered water extractors, air movers to circulate air and speed up evaporation, and dehumidifiers to remove moisture from the air. For structural elements, we also use mo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to ensure materials are dried to safe levels. This equipment is key to thorough structural drying.
